Output 7120b40f02caf28c4653d3bd6bf428cc42597a23289e3a337d5dee37a315d67c:0

value
674126289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5691c53956139c52638be13b2f25a8baf1759f6909a920d427f322a30910be5c
address
tb1p26gu2w2kzww9ycutuyaj7fdghtcht8mfpx5jp4p87v32xzgshewqe8c3de
transaction
7120b40f02caf28c4653d3bd6bf428cc42597a23289e3a337d5dee37a315d67c
confirmations
23371
spent
true